Reich v. Rosenblatt

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, First Department
Oct 9, 1951
279 App. Div. 561 (N.Y. App. Div. 1951)

Opinion

October 9, 1951.

Present — Peck, P.J., Glennon, Dore, Callahan and Shientag, JJ.;


Judgment affirmed, with costs. No opinion.


Dore and Shientag, JJ., dissent and vote to reverse and deny specific performance to the plaintiff.
